Everyday jewelry collects lotion, soap scum, skin oils, and dust that dim sparkle over time. The safest home routine is simple: mix warm water with a few drops of mild dish soap, soak pieces for a few minutes, gently brush with a soft toothbrush, rinse, and pat dry with a lint‑free cloth. Avoid bleach, harsh chemicals, and abrasive powders—they can scratch metal and etch gemstones. Delicate pieces such as pearls, opals, emeralds, turquoise, antique items, or anything with glued‑in stones should never be exposed to ultrasonic cleaners or steam; stick to the gentle soap method for those.
Hard gemstones like diamonds, sapphires, and rubies often tolerate more robust cleaning, but mounting condition matters just as much as the stone. If prongs are worn or a stone is slightly loose, vigorous brushing or home devices can make things worse. A quick in‑store inspection catches loosened settings, thinning prongs, worn clasps, and stretched chains before they become costly losses. A professional clean and check every few months restores brilliance and provides peace of mind, especially for heirlooms and engagement rings.
